A peaceful spot in the Dorset National Landscape, within easy reach of the famed Jurassic Coast and with lots nearby for history and heritage buffs? Sounds like a lucky catch… and that’s not all to reel you in at Lyons Gate Caravan Park and Fishery, a family-friendly site less than 10 minutes’ drive from the scenic Dorset village of Cerne Abbas. This site is heaven for anyone angling to do a spot of fishing on their hols: there are four well-stocked lakes here where casting a line could land perch, chub, roach, tench, rudd, barbel or 20-pound+ carp – plenty to keep novices and experts entertained for days. When nothing’s biting, hunger can be kept at bay with a cheeky takeaway, and there are a couple of pubs in Cerne Abbas if local eats are on the menu. Not hooked on spending getaways on the banks? Nature trails crisscross the woodland on site, or you can venture out into the National Landscape to wander the Jurassic Coast, lounge around on sandy beaches, and follow the Thomas Hardy trail to see Dorset as the poet and novelist did.

Local attractions

Cerne Abbas has been called ‘Britain’s most desirable village’ to live in and it’s easy to see why. Start stays with a ramble around the stunningly pretty village, stopping in at the pubs to sample the local beer and tottering along to Cerne Abbey where the village’s tradition of brewing began. Of course, beer isn’t what Cerne Abbas is most famous for, so a trip to the Cerne Abbas Giant (a chalk hill figure of a happily anatomically correct man) comes highly recommended. There’s a viewing spot in the village and closer looks are a stroll away along a waymarked circular trail managed by the National Trust. If naked desires (sorry) skew more towards grand estates, Minterne House and Gardens are less than five minutes from base – the house isn’t open to the public, but it’s a spectacular backdrop to wanders among Himalayan gardens, designed in the style of Capability Brown. More urban days are within easy reach at Dorchester, 20 minutes away. The town is the birthplace of Thomas Hardy, and visits to Hardy’s Cottage and his home later in life (Max Gate) are absolute musts. It’s not just literary history here either: there’s the Tutankhamun Exhibition, a Roman amphitheatre, a display of Terracotta Warrior replicas, and a handful of museums for everything from teddy bears to dinosaurs.
